Trump says Nikki Haley and Mike Pompeo won’t be asked to return in second administration

(Worthy Insights) – US President-elect Donald Trump ruled out on Saturday re-appointing two senior figures from his first administration, ex-secretary of state Mike Pompeo and former UN ambassador Nikki Haley.

Writing on his Truth Social social network, Trump said he “will not be inviting” either figure to join his administration as speculation swirls about the identity of his new team.

Pompeo had outlined a hawkish plan for Ukraine in July involving more weapons transfers and tough action against Russia’s energy sector which analysts noted on Saturday was at odds with Trump’s campaign statements. [ Source (Read More…) ]

German MPs pass resolution to defund BDS

(Worthy Insights) – An overwhelming majority of the German parliament’s lower house voted on Thursday in favor of a resolution that calls for excluding boycotters of Israel from public funding and acknowledges the link between Muslim immigration and antisemitism.

The motion received the support of all the parties of Germany’s left-leaning ruling coalition, which has 415 out of 733 seats in the Bundestag. The center-right Christian Democratic Union (CDU), which helped co-author the resolution, added its 196 seats. The Alternative for Germany (AfD) also supported the resolution with its 76 seats, meaning it had the support of 93% of the Bundestag.

The Left party, which has 28 seats, abstained during the vote, and the far-left Sahra Wagenknecht Alliance, which has 10 seats, was the only political party that voted against the resolution, according to the Tagesschau news site. [ Source (Read More…) ]

Federal judge tosses Illinois’ ban on semiautomatic weapons

(Worthy Insights) – A federal judge has overturned Illinois’ ban on semiautomatic weapons, leaning on recent U.S. Supreme Court rulings that strictly interpret the Second Amendment right to keep and bear firearms.

U.S. District Judge Stephen P. McGlynn’s said his Friday decision applied universally, not just to the lawsuit’s plaintiffs.

The Protect Illinois Communities Act, signed into law in January 2023 by Democratic Gov. J.B. Pritzker, took effect Jan. 1. It bans AR-15 rifles and similar guns, large-capacity magazines and an assortment of attachments largely in response to the 2022 Independence Day shooting at a parade in the Chicago suburb of Highland Park. Israel signs $5.2 billion deal for next-generation F-15 fighter jets

(Worthy Insights) – The Defense Ministry signed a $5.2 billion agreement with Boeing on Wednesday to purchase 25 advanced F-15IA fighter jets, funded through U.S. military aid.

The deal includes an option for 25 additional jets in the future. According to the ministry, jet deliveries will begin in 2031, with 4–6 planes arriving annually.

The authorization was signed by Defense Ministry Director-General Maj. Gen. (res.) Eyal Zamir during a visit to the U.S. last month, following negotiations led by Israel’s procurement delegation and the Israeli Air Force. [ Source: Ynet News (Read More…) ]

DOJ moving to wind down Trump criminal cases before he takes office

(Worthy Insights) – Justice Department officials have been evaluating how to wind down the two federal criminal cases against President-elect Donald Trump before he takes office to comply with long-standing department policy that a sitting president can’t be prosecuted, two people familiar with the matter tell NBC News.

The latest discussions stand in contrast with the pre-election legal posture of special counsel Jack Smith, who in recent weeks took significant steps in the election interference case against Trump without regard to the electoral calendar.

But the sources say DOJ officials have come to grips with the fact that no trial is possible anytime soon in either the Jan. 6 case or the classified documents matter — both of which are mired in legal issues that would likely prompt an appeal all the way to the Supreme Court, even if Trump had lost the election. 43 monkeys escape South Carolina research facility; police warn residents to secure doors and windows

(Worthy Insights) – Authorities in South Carolina on Thursday warned residents to lock their doors and windows after more than 40 monkeys escaped from a research facility.

The primates broke loose from a Alpha Genesis facility in Beaufort County and traps have been set up and thermal imaging cameras are being used in an effort to locate the fugitive monkeys, the Yemassee Police Department said in a statement.

In an update posted Thursday, police confirmed 43 rhesus macaque primates escaped and none had been captured as of early afternoon. Authorities said the primates were “very young females weighing approximately 6-7 lbs” and had never been used for testing due to their age. [ Source (Read More…) ]

How will Iran’s proxies in Iraq respond to US election? – analysis

(Worthy Insights) – Before the US election, the Iranian-backed militias in Iraq were increasing their drone threats to Israel. They have been launching drones and making more statements about potential involvement in attacks on Israel. The militias are part of the larger Iranian-backed milieu in the region.

There is no doubt that Iranian messaging after the US election is that Tehran and its axis of “resistance” will continue their attacks. Ali Fadavi, the deputy commander-in-chief of the Islamic Revolutionary Guard Corps (IRGC), said, “Iran and the Resistance Front are ready, and the Zionists cannot confront us, and they must await our response.”

The Iraqi militias represent a clear and present danger to Israel and the region, as well as to US troops in Iraq and Syria. During the first Trump administration, the militias increased their power and role in Iraq, many bolstered after ISIS invaded in 2014, and recruited based on a fatwa by Ayatollah Ali Sistani. After 2017, they then turned their recruits to conduct other operations in Iraq, with some moving towards threats to Israel – including Kataib Hezbollah, Asaib Ahl al-Haq, and Harakat Hezbollah al-Nujaba.
